Your thoughts may be out to get you. Okay, so maybe they don’t literally have it out for you. But your life is directly influenced by what thoughts you entertain at any given moment. Are you happy with life? Do you consider yourself a success? If you’re searching for the secrets of success, then look to your mind – and more specifically what’s in it on a daily basis – as the key that unlocks the door to your ultimate life.

Every single day of your life is shaped by the beliefs and ideas you’ve collected since you were little. This accumulated knowledge is either helping you or hurting you at any given moment. So often,those who are constantly lacking - be it for income, happiness, quality relationships or any other need - rely on false ideas and misguided understandings about themselves, others, and the way the world works. It’s not what you don’t know, it’s what you know that can impact your life in a negative way. Whatever beliefs are rolling around in your head – good or bad – they manipulate your feelings, which affects action and then eventually the results you live with each day. So if you’re not happy with your life, consider in a heartfelt way the ideas you have about the things you lack and how they are producing the results you don’t want.

Since wealth is a problem for many, let’s examine some beliefs and ideas you may have about it. Do you find yourself envious and even angry towards the rich? Do you believe the wealthy are where they’re at because they “screw people over?” Do you feel the common, working man is a better all-around person than someone who’s wealthy? Now reflect on your thoughts surrounding the workplace. Do you feel only the “suck-ups” get the high-paying promotions? And do you think you would get that raise if only the high-paid executives would stop hoarding it for themselves?

The list is endless. But understand that these kind of thoughts and assumptions keep you from creating wealth. Your past experiences and mental conditioning are laying boobie traps that do nothing more than create anger and jealousy – just the kinds of things that keep you from getting what you want. When you’re busy thinking about how badly you feel and the poor state of your life, and how it’s the fault of everyone else but yourself, then not only do you get more of the same, but you certainly won’t be taking steps to create something better. You revel in your own pity party which is unfortunately the path of least resistance and the quickest route to keeping your life exactly as it’s always been. Those who know that cultivating success skills lead to a better life understand the best way is to replace negative thoughts that weaken their success with constructive ones that empower them.

No matter what life offers up, you either create new success or rehash old results based on what you allow to shape your thoughts and attitude. Remember: you put trash in and you get trash out. Replace the trash with thoughts of value and you’ll reap the riches of life.
